anniewysocki09 created a new article
2 w

Mastering Online Baccarat | #casino Game

Mastering Online Baccarat

The Rise of Mobile Slots
The rise of mobile technology has led to a booming marketplace for mobile slots, permitting gamers to get pleasure from their favorite video games on-the-go.